In today’s fast-paced business world, workers are becoming increasingly interested in driving their own success. This urge to take charge of their professional futures is what inspired the creation of technology to help them do just that, using analytics. This effort to help employees determine trainings and career moves necessary for advancement in their field is expected to have a positive impact in the workplace, as employees will be able to see opportunities for advancement within their company. This technology will also help employers find employees that could thrive in other roles, positioning people strategically based on performance. Proper placement will also help with retention as happier employees last longer.
